Unlocking the Secrets of Successful Condo Renovations

Condo living is becoming increasingly popular, and for good reason. Condos offer a sense of community and often come with amenities such as swimming pools and fitness centers. However, one of the downsides of living in a condo is that you are subject to the rules and regulations set forth by the condo association. This can make it difficult to make changes to your unit, such as renovating.

Before you start your renovation project, it’s important to understand the rules and regulations of your specific condo association. These rules are typically outlined in the association’s bylaws and can include restrictions on what types of renovations are allowed, as well as guidelines for getting approval for your project.

It’s also important to note that even if your association’s bylaws do not explicitly prohibit certain types of renovations, you may still need to get approval from the association’s board. This is because any changes to the common areas of the building, such as the lobby or hallways, may need to be approved.

Navigating the Rules and Regulations of Condo Renovations

One of the best ways to ensure that your renovation project is approved is to work with a reputable contractor who is familiar with the rules and regulations of your specific condo association. A good contractor will be able to guide you through the approval process and ensure that your project meets all of the necessary requirements.

It’s also a good idea to consult with an attorney who specializes in real estate law, particularly in the case of renovation projects that are not allowed by the association’s bylaws, an attorney can help you to understand your rights and how to negotiate with the association.

In addition, you should also consider the cost of your renovation project and whether or not it is worth it in the long run. While you may want to make certain changes to your unit, it’s important to remember that you will be living in the condo for a while and that any changes you make will need to be maintained.

Before you decide to buy a condo

It’s important to have a clear understanding of the association’s rules and regulations regarding renovations. It’s a good idea to ask the association for a copy of their bylaws and to review them carefully. This will give you an idea of what types of renovations are allowed and what the approval process looks like.

It’s also a good idea to speak with current residents of the building to get a sense of their experiences with the association and the approval process for renovations. This can give you valuable insight into what you can expect if you decide to buy a unit and make renovations.

Before buying a condo, it’s also important to consider the cost of any potential renovations. While you may be able to make certain changes to your unit, it’s important to remember that you will be living in the condo for a while and that any changes you make will need to be maintained. You should factor in the cost of any potential renovations into your overall budget, so you can make an informed decision about whether or not to buy a unit in the building.

Expectations and Higher Price Tag of Condo Renovations

It’s important to note that renovating a condo usually comes with a higher price tag than renovating a freehold property. This is because of the added layer of complexity involved in getting approval for renovations from the condo association. Additionally, there may be restrictions on what types of renovations are allowed and specific materials or methods that must be used. This can add to the cost of the renovation project.
